		<description>Just a note to say The P-P program will be a big assest  to the ApHC. Since previoulsy Appaloosa to Appaloosa solid foal can be shown,  specators at the shows will have no way of knowing  if the solid horse being shown is from Appaloosa to Appaloosa  or from Appaloosa to an approved breed since both are solid. 
How the ApHC  handles the money received  from the P-P program is important. I think the ApHC should keep 30 per cent and then payback 70 percent,  to colored horses only, for  National Points earned at Regional clubs. A ceretain amount per point. This will be an incentive to buy an Appaloosa horse and show it at  Regional shows.

I like the idea of getting the older horses registered, it will help increase the ApHC numbers in different ways.

Keep up the good work in promoting the Appaloosa horse.
